Job Description
Summary


Performs receptionist, registration, and clerical duties associated with registering patient for inpatient and outpatient services.


Detailed Responsibilities


  • Round with patients in practice to ensure Excellent Patient Experience is met. Follow-up on reported issues and assist with service recovery.
  • Builds critically important relationships with physicians, OR staff, as well as insurance representatives in order to help facilitate all scheduling duties.
  • Responsible for managing physician calendars.
  • Performs general clerical duties including assisting with the front/back desk as well as scheduling appointments. Assist with signing up patients/Proxy with MyChart activations and Telehealth visits.
  • Reviews patient charts to ensure imaging is available and all pertinent information to maximize appointment.
  • Verifies insurance benefits and obtains pre-certification/authorization as necessary. Determines and accepts required payments, including co-pays and deductibles, or refers to financial counselors for follow up.
  • Communicates with referring physician's office, clinical department(s), and/or other appropriate personnel to exchange necessary information and coordinate surgical/procedural/diagnostic testing and DME as appropriate. Assists in completing surgical orders as directed by department. Routes as appropriate.
  • Meets with surgical/procedural patient or patient's caregiver to exchange necessary information and documentation. Provides explanation of process, pre-procedure instructions, and addresses concerns and questions. Schedule patient/family surgical conferences.
  • Work Department incoming referral work queue daily. Assist patients with appointments in other specialist offices as requested/referred by our physicians.
